201 =head2 transferbook
203 ($dotransfer, $messages, $iteminformation) = &transferbook($newbranch,
204 $barcode, $ignore_reserves);
206 Transfers an item to a new branch. If the item is currently on loan, it is automatically returned before the actual transfer.
208 C<$newbranch> is the code for the branch to which the item should be transferred.
210 C<$barcode> is the barcode of the item to be transferred.
212 If C<$ignore_reserves> is true, C<&transferbook> ignores reserves.
213 Otherwise, if an item is reserved, the transfer fails.
215 Returns three values:
217 =over
219 =item $dotransfer
221 is true if the transfer was successful.
223 =item $messages
225 is a reference-to-hash which may have any of the following keys:
227 =over
229 =item C<BadBarcode>
231 There is no item in the catalog with the given barcode. The value is C<$barcode>.
233 =item C<IsPermanent>
235 The item's home branch is permanent. This doesn't prevent the item from being transferred, though. The value is the code of the item's home branch.
237 =item C<DestinationEqualsHolding>
239 The item is already at the branch to which it is being transferred. The transfer is nonetheless considered to have failed. The value should be ignored.
241 =item C<WasReturned>
243 The item was on loan, and C<&transferbook> automatically returned it before transferring it. The value is the borrower number of the patron who had the item.
245 =item C<ResFound>
247 The item was reserved. The value is a reference-to-hash whose keys are fields from the reserves table of the Koha database, and C<biblioitemnumber>. It also has the key C<ResFound>, whose value is either C<Waiting> or C<Reserved>.
249 =item C<WasTransferred>
251 The item was eligible to be transferred. Barring problems communicating with the database, the transfer should indeed have succeeded. The value should be ignored.
253 =back
255 =back

1191 =head2 GetBranchBorrowerCircRule
1193 my $branch_cat_rule = GetBranchBorrowerCircRule($branchcode, $categorycode);
1195 Retrieves circulation rule attributes that apply to the given
1196 branch and patron category, regardless of item type.
1197 The return value is a hashref containing the following key:
1199 maxissueqty - maximum number of loans that a
1200 patron of the given category can have at the given
1201 branch. If the value is undef, no limit.
1203 This will first check for a specific branch and
1204 category match from branch_borrower_circ_rules.
1206 If no rule is found, it will then check default_branch_circ_rules
1207 (same branch, default category). If no rule is found,
1208 it will then check default_borrower_circ_rules (default
1209 branch, same category), then failing that, default_circ_rules
1210 (default branch, default category).
1212 If no rule has been found in the database, it will default to
1213 the buillt in rule:
1215 maxissueqty - undef
1217 C<$branchcode> and C<$categorycode> should contain the
1218 literal branch code and patron category code, respectively - no
1219 wildcards.

1274 =head2 GetBranchItemRule
1276 my $branch_item_rule = GetBranchItemRule($branchcode, $itemtype);
1278 Retrieves circulation rule attributes that apply to the given
1279 branch and item type, regardless of patron category.
1281 The return value is a hashref containing the following key:
1283 holdallowed => Hold policy for this branch and itemtype. Possible values:
1284 0: No holds allowed.
1285 1: Holds allowed only by patrons that have the same homebranch as the item.
1286 2: Holds allowed from any patron.
1288 This searches branchitemrules in the following order:
1290 * Same branchcode and itemtype
1291 * Same branchcode, itemtype '*'
1292 * branchcode '*', same itemtype
1293 * branchcode and itemtype '*'
1295 Neither C<$branchcode> nor C<$categorycode> should be '*'.

1334 =head2 AddReturn
1336 ($doreturn, $messages, $iteminformation, $borrower) =
1337 &AddReturn($barcode, $branch, $exemptfine, $dropbox);
1339 Returns a book.
1341 =over 4
1343 =item C<$barcode> is the bar code of the book being returned.
1345 =item C<$branch> is the code of the branch where the book is being returned.
1347 =item C<$exemptfine> indicates that overdue charges for the item will be
1348 removed.
1350 =item C<$dropbox> indicates that the check-in date is assumed to be
1351 yesterday, or the last non-holiday as defined in C4::Calendar . If
1352 overdue charges are applied and C<$dropbox> is true, the last charge
1353 will be removed. This assumes that the fines accrual script has run
1354 for _today_.
1356 =back
1358 C<&AddReturn> returns a list of four items:
1360 C<$doreturn> is true iff the return succeeded.
1362 C<$messages> is a reference-to-hash giving feedback on the operation.
1363 The keys of the hash are:
1365 =over 4
1367 =item C<BadBarcode>
1369 No item with this barcode exists. The value is C<$barcode>.
1371 =item C<NotIssued>
1373 The book is not currently on loan. The value is C<$barcode>.
1375 =item C<IsPermanent>
1377 The book's home branch is a permanent collection. If you have borrowed
1378 this book, you are not allowed to return it. The value is the code for
1379 the book's home branch.
1381 =item C<wthdrawn>
1383 This book has been withdrawn/cancelled. The value should be ignored.
1385 =item C<Wrongbranch>
1387 This book has was returned to the wrong branch. The value is a hashref
1388 so that C<$messages->{Wrongbranch}->{Wrongbranch}> and C<$messages->{Wrongbranch}->{Rightbranch}>
1389 contain the branchcode of the incorrect and correct return library, respectively.
1391 =item C<ResFound>
1393 The item was reserved. The value is a reference-to-hash whose keys are
1394 fields from the reserves table of the Koha database, and
1395 C<biblioitemnumber>. It also has the key C<ResFound>, whose value is
1396 either C<Waiting>, C<Reserved>, or 0.
1398 =back
1400 C<$iteminformation> is a reference-to-hash, giving information about the
1401 returned item from the issues table.
1403 C<$borrower> is a reference-to-hash, giving information about the
1404 patron who last borrowed the book.
